Hand ting

· noun · uk-drill

A handgun — UK-drill phrasing that crossed the Atlantic.

Definitions

1

A handgun. "Ting" is Jamaican-rooted Caribbean-British slang for thing — so hand ting is literally a hand-thing, a pistol you can conceal in one fist. UK drill out of London birthed it; NYC drill picked it up via the Brooklyn-to-Brixton pipeline.

“Tucked the hand ting in his waistband before stepping out.”
